WebGenFree: One Page Business Website Generator
A professional, no-code tool to create stunning one-page business websites in minutes. Build, customize, preview in real-time, and download a production-ready ZIP file of your website—completely for free.
🚀 Features
- Live Real-time Preview: See your changes instantly as you type.
- Section-Wise Editing: Complete control over Header, Hero, About, Services, and Contact sections.
- All Features Free: Access premium features like image galleries and custom fonts without any cost.
- Production-Ready Export: Generates a clean, standalone ZIP file with all assets embedded.
- Fully Responsive: Your created sites look great on Mobile, Tablet, and Desktop.
- No Backend Needed: Works entirely as a static site, making it easy to host and deploy.
- Privacy First: No login required. Your data stays in your browser.
🛠️ How to Use
- Open
index.html to see the landing page.
- Click “Start Building” to enter the builder.
- Fill in your business details into the sidebar panels.
- Choose your preferred Theme and Font.
- Click “Download Your Website” to get your files instantly.
📁 Project Structure
/index.html - The landing/intro page.
/builder.html - The main application interface.
/css/landing.css - Styles for the landing page.
/css/styles.css - Styles for the builder application.
/js/script.js - Core logic for the builder and ZIP generation.
/assets/ - Directory for images and icons.
🌍 How to Deploy on GitHub Pages
- Create a New Repository: Create a new repo on GitHub (e.g.,
web-builder).
- Upload Files: Upload all the files from this directory to the repository.
- Configure GitHub Pages:
- Go to Settings -> Pages.
- In the “Build and deployment” section, under “Source”, select Deploy from a branch.
- Select the main branch and / (root) folder.
- Click Save.
- Live Link: After a minute, your site will be live at
https://your-username.github.io/web-builder/.
Built with ❤️ for entrepreneurs and small businesses. Ready to help you grow without the cost.